    Hi,
    EWM can cancel an open pick WT. What it says in the docu is " If open pick warehouse tasks of this kind exist, EWM cancels these without violating the FIFO principle."
    Well, in reality it is not that simple. First of all the open WTs must be RF relevant (you wrote you have a queue, but it must be an RF-queue (which I suppose you have)). The other thing is the question with FIFO. Now it does make sense that EWM does not cancel a WT if the already assigned quantity is older then the one you have in the GR zone. But what acutally happens is that the system checks the goods removal rule being used for the open WT. If this one uses the GR date or the SLE date, then the system does NOT cancel the WT. This is part of the standard BADI implementation you have to have to CD. And this is where you have to put in your own logic.

  • Cross Docking with LE-WM - or - Reactivating Back Orders upon Goods Receipt

    I have been reviewing the documentation for Opportunistic and Planned Cross Docking in LE-WM. The requirement is to release Back Orders upon receipt of a shipment to avoid putting them away and picking them right away from the bin. We want to release the Back Orders for picking in the GR area at the time of receipt.
    So far it appears that Opportunistic Cross Docking depends on a Transfer Order already existing. The system then cancels the existing TO and replaces it with a TO to pick from the receipt Storage Type.
    Planned Cross Docking appears to require an existing Outbound Delivery to the expected Inbound Delivery.
    In the case of a Back Order, no Outbound Delivery or Transfer Order exist since there is no stock to release until the goods are received.
    Is there a way to release Back Orders to be picked directly from Goods Receipt?

    Hi Susil,
    Cross-docking implies moving materials directly from the incoming to the outgoing physical areas of the warehouse. To process these materials without first putting them into storage, the warehouse must be aware of what deliveries are coming in and which deliveries are going out.
    Inbound delivery helps in planning of incoming Materials in the Warehouse hence can make use of effective implementation of Cross Docking.

    Hi,
    Planned cross docking  enables two-step cross-docking, where goods to be cross-docked are first moved from the goods receipt (GR) area to a cross-docking storage type. The goods are subsequently moved to the goods issue (GI) area upon release of the outbound document. Hence after the system suggesting normal storage type, you need to transfer stock to cross docking area. Thanking you.
